Nighy: The lazy stars who won’t learn their lines

-

ACTORS are routinely turning up for filming not knowing their lines, Bill Nighy said.

The Love Actually star, right, told the Cheltenham Literature Festival it was now ‘fashionabl­e’ to arrive for rehearsals unprepared.

Asked by an audience member for advice for young actors, the 67-year-old said: ‘If you’re doing anything, if it’s a play, or a film ... learn every single word that you have to say backwards, forwards and sideways before you go into a rehearsal room – and obviously before you go on a film set.

‘That might sound like an obvious thing, but it’s not currently. There is a fashion for not knowing your lines. It’s been invented by people who don’t want to do their homework, obviously, and even as a creative choice.’

The British star also said many actors made ‘millions of dollars’ just by ‘standing still and keeping a straight face’.
